Blocks of mass 15, 30, and 90 kg are lined up from left to right in that order on a frictionless surface so each block is touching the next one. A rightnard-pointing force of magnitude 24 N is applied to the left-most block. 13) What is the magnitude of the force that the left block exert on the middle one? N 14) What is the magnitude of the force that the middle block exert on the left one? N 15) What is the magnitude of the force that the middle block exerts on the rightmost one? N 16) Now the position of the right two masses are flipped. What is the magnitude of the force that the middle block exerts on the right block? NExplanation / Answer
net acceleration of all three block=a=F/(M1+M2+M3)
=.18 m/s^2
a) force exerted by left one on middle =a*(M2+M3)=.18*(30+90)=21.6N
b)force on left one by middle=F-aM1=24-2.7=21.6 N
c)force by middle on right =a*M3=16.2 N
